Transaction 56b30b40a5496ccd20bc6fc4b1bb4aa9091f50fc3c12003911475d397b3895ad
1 Input
1 Output
-
56b30b40a5496ccd20bc6fc4b1bb4aa9091f50fc3c12003911475d397b3895ad:0
- value
- 816312
- script pubkey
- OP_0 OP_PUSHBYTES_20 abefee5bfb14e100ebecf9cb64f67eb405232c81
- address
- bc1q40h7uklmznssp6lvl89kfan7kszjxtyp47z3cj